2017 SESSION
SB 1178 Buprenorphine without naloxone; prescription limitation.
Introduced by: A. Benton "Ben" Chafin | all patrons ... notes | add to my profiles
SUMMARY AS PASSED: (all summaries)
Prescription of buprenorphine without naloxone; limitation. Provides that prescriptions for products containing buprenorphine without naloxone shall be issued only (i) for patients who are pregnant, (ii) when converting a patient from methadone to buprenorphine containing naloxone for a period not to exceed seven days, or (iii) as permitted by regulations of the Board of Medicine or the Board of Nursing. The bill contains an emergency clause and has an expiration date of July 1, 2022. This bill is identical to HB 2163.
